当前位置: 首页 > 名字大全

做网页的软件叫什么(网页制作软件名称)

网页制作软件的深度解析与实战指南 工具认知评述 在当下的数字化浪潮中,网页制作软件早已不再是单纯的工具,而是连接创意与现实的桥梁。从早期的静态 HTML 时代,到如今拥有丰富的后端集成本事,这些软件极大地下降了开发门槛。市面上常见的工具主要分为三类:前端开发框架、全栈综合平台还有轻量级静态生成器。 前端开发框架如 React 和 Vue,供给了组件化、响应式的开发方案,适合构建复杂的动态应用。全栈平台则往往一站式集成数据库、中间件等后端本事,适合快速搭建企业级网站。而静态生成器则关切极致性能与 SEO,专为单页应用设计。选择何种工具,取决于项目标复杂程度、团队的技术栈倾向还有对性能与开发效率的权衡。对于新手而言,理解不同工具的核心逻辑与适用场景,是迈出第一步的关键。 技术选型与入门路径 2.1 主流工具对比

React

做	网页的软件叫啥

作为前端生态的核心,React 凭借社区赞成与生态完善,麻利成为主流选择。其组件化思维下降了代码复用成本,适合构建大型 SPA。
不过,学习曲线相对陡峭,需求掌握 JSX 语法与状态管理。

Vue

Vue 的学习成本较低,语法简洁,无需复杂工具链。其渐进式特性让开发者能灵活选择参与程度,贼适合个人开发者快速上手和原型验证。

WordPress

作为 CMS 代表,WordPress 无需编程即可拥有强大功能。它适合内容型网站,但插件生态依赖外部,维护更新需人工干预,适合非技术出身的运营者。

WordPress.org

这是独立托管方案,拥有独立服务器,性能优于 WordPress.com 的托管服务,是专业网站的首选。

Next.js

基于 React 的服务器端渲染版本,性能卓越,SEO 友好。适合对速度要求高的企业级项目,但初期学习难度较高。

2.2 开发者选择指南

个人开发者与初创团队

推荐使用 VueNext.js。Vue 适合快速搭建 MVP(最小可行性产品),Next.js 则能兼顾性能与 SEO。两者均赞成云端部署,下降服务器维护成本。

企业级或大型项目

应优先寻思 React 生态中的大型框架,或搭建自己的后端服务。React 拥有最丰富的第三方库,便于快速集成物流、支付等复杂功能。
同时要注意下,结合 Node.js 后端能够构建高并发系统。

快速原型或静态页

直接使用 WordPress静态生成器 最为高效。后者适合展示型网站,内容加载极快,彻底由前端 JS 管住,适合手机端优先的场景。

2.3 核心功能模块解析

前端构建工具

在大型项目中,DevTools 至关关键。如 Vite 能比传统 CLI 更快启动项目,供给热重载与远程缓存。配合 Webpack 进行代码打包优化,可显著提升首屏加载速度。

代码规范与协作

引入 ESLintPrettier 可自动检测代码毛病与格式化难题,提升团队效率。版本管住工具 Git 务必掌握,配合 GitHubGitee 进行代码管理与合并,确保版本迭代有序。

数据库与后端交互

对于需求持久化数据的场景,务必集成 PostgreSQLMongoDBMySQL 等数据库。
同时要注意下,通过 Socket.io 实现前端实时推送,或通过 RESTful API 与后端服务通信。

2.4 部署与性能优化

云部署服务

造环境部署需选择高可用服务。腾讯云、阿里云或 AWS 均供给 CDN 加速、全球节点部署及自动负载均衡。
同时要注意下,开启 HTTPS 强制协议,保障数据保险。

性能优化策略

合理设置服务器响应头,如 Cache-ControlETag,配合 Gzip 压缩,可大幅削减传输数据量。利用 CDN 缓存静态资源,解决跨国访问延迟难题。
优化图片资源,采用 WebP 格式与懒加载技术,亦是提升用户体验的关键。

监控与维护

部署后需接入 ELK 栈进行日志收集与分析,利用 APM 工具监控应用性能,及时发现并解决瓶颈,确保系统稳定运行。

2.5 前端框架演进与未来

单一语言之争

不要认为 VueReact 竞争激烈,但联盟策略正促成立体生态。
不同语言(如 JavaScript、TypeScript)的渲染引擎不断融合,新的 API 接口将层出不穷,推动技术栈持续进化。

人工智能的影响

不要认为 AI 尚未彻底取代开发者,但 AI 辅助编码工具 将越来越普及。它们能生成基础代码框架,辅助理解文档,就连进行快速原型生成,显著缩短开发周期。

移动端优先

随着 Progressive Web Apps 的兴起,传统浏览器与移动端间的鸿沟正在缩小。跨端框架的发展将使得一套代码能省事适配 iPhone、Android、iOS 等多种设备,创造更极致的用户体验。

服务器端渲染的关键性

SEO 排名权重向服务端渲染倾斜,NuxtSvelteKit 等平台将持续拓展服务端渲染本事,让网页加载更快,点击转化更高。

2.6 保险与合规

数据加密

所有涉及用户信息的页面务必实施 HTTPS 加密传输。敏感数据需加密存,防止泄露。保持服务器端代码保险,定期更新库与依赖,防止漏洞被利用。

权限管住

结合 RBAC(基于角色的访问管住)与 ABAC(基于属性的访问管住),可实现细粒度的权限管理。比方说,不同部门只能访问其权限范围内的 URL 或数据列表。

合规性审查

在上线前,务必评估产品是否符合当地法律法规,如 GDPR(通用数据保护条例)或 个人信息保护法。确保数据采集、存与使用符合当地要求,避免法律风险。

2.7 测试与质量保障

自动化测试

集成 JestVitest 进行单元测试,覆盖核心逻辑。使用 PlaywrightCypress 进行端到端测试,确保界面交互与数据流转对无误。

性能测试

利用 Lighthouse 自动评估网页在移动设备上的表现。通过 LoadRunnerJMeter 进行压力测试,验证服务器在高并发下的稳定性与响应工夫。

漏洞扫描

部署 SnykKestra 等工具,自动扫描代码中的保险漏洞,及时修复,保障应用整体保险。

2.8 行业案例实践

电商场景

大型电商平台如 TikTok ShopNike 一般采用 React + Next.js 架构,配合 Node.js 后端。通过 WebSocket 实现实时推荐与库存同步,利用 Redis 缓存热点商品数据,确保毫秒级响应。

内容社区

新闻类平台如 MediumBilibili 多采用 Vue 构建前端,配合 MySQL 存大量图文数据。利用 WebSocket 推送实时评论,通过 Gzip 压缩图片资源,保障海量流量下的流畅体验。

企业内部系统

内部管理系统(如 HR 系统、OA)多使用 Java 开发,结合 Spring Boot 框架,通过 JDBC 或ORM 在数据库进行持久化操作。确保数据一致性,保障核心业务不中断。

个人博客

个人博客博主首选 WordPressHexo。利用 Opsgenie 插件自动备份,通过 Cloudflare 加速页面加载,实现低维护成本与高访问速度的完美结合。

2.9 新兴技术趋势

边缘计算

随着 5G 普及,计算任务可下放到靠近用户的边缘设备。结合 WebAssembly,实现更复杂的算法在浏览器端直接运行,削减服务器压力,下降延迟。

WebAssembly

该标准让浏览器有类似服务器的执行本事,适用于复杂计算密集型应用,如科学可视化或金融交易终端。

原子化开发

引入 Atomic Design 理念,将界面拆解为原子组件,通过逻辑与样式复用,极大提升代码复用率与开发效率,下降维护成本。

Serverless 架构

借助 FaaS(函数计算),开发者无需管理服务器,按使用量付费。适合构建弹性伸缩、自托管的 HTTP 服务,弹性极强且成本可控。

2.10 总结提升

持续学习

网页制作技术迭代麻利,唯有持续学习新框架、新工具,才能跟上行业发展步伐。保持好奇心,关切开源社区动态,是开发者成长的必经之路。

实战经验

多动手实践,尝试不同的工具组合,记录遇到的难题与解决方案,积累项目经验。将理论知识应用于实际场景,才能真正掌握技术精髓。

团队协作

现代网页开发往往涉及前后端分离、测试、运维等多角色。良好的沟通与协作本事,是项目最终成功的关键因素。

最终目标

甭管使用何种工具,最终目标都是为用户供给流畅、保险、美观的网页体验,并高效搞定开发任务。让我们以专业的态度,积极探索技术边界,创造更多价值。

打个总结

选择网页制作软件,本质上是一场关于效率与规模的博弈。从好办的静态页面到复杂的动态应用,工具的选择直接影响项目标走向与成果。通过深入理解各主流框架的优劣、特性及适用场景,开发者能够做出更明智的决策。

甭管是选择 React 构建宏大架构,还是依托 WordPress 快速上线内容,亦或是利用 静态生成器 实现极致性能,核心都在于对技术与需求的深刻理解。

做	网页的软件叫啥

在技术日新月异的今天,保持开放心态,勇于尝试新技术,是每一位网页开发者的必修课。让我们携手并进,在数字化世界中书写更加精彩的篇章。

相关标签:

猜你喜欢

热门阅读

  • 材料数据库如何查(材料数据库检索方法)
  • 电气工程师助理报考条件(电气助理报考条件)
  • 八年级全县统考成绩(八年级全县统考成绩)
  • 农村医学报考(农村医学专业报考)
  • 生殖器疱疹如何诊查(生殖器疱疹诊查方法)

其他分站